Frequently Asked Questions About solar generator for charging power tools

How do I choose the right solar generator for charging power tools?

Choose a solar generator by matching your tools’ wattage, the required runtime, and the unit’s charging and outlet options. The inverter should handle the highest tool draw, and the battery capacity (Wh) determines how long you can run before recharging. Check the solar input to ensure you can recharge quickly under your typical sun hours. Look for trusted brands and series such as COLASOLAR, Duravolt, or generic solar-battery-chargers to ensure reliability and support. Ensure you have the right mix of outlets (AC, USB) and that the device uses a pure sine wave for sensitive tools.

What is the most complex attribute to consider when selecting a solar generator for charging power tools, and how does it work?

The tricky balance is between battery capacity (Wh), inverter output (W), and solar input (W), which together determine runtime and recharge speed. Battery capacity governs how long your tools can run between charges, while the inverter must supply enough continuous power for the tools’ peak demand. The solar input (often via an MPPT charger) decides how fast the unit recharges in sun, based on panel wattage and sun hours. In practice, higher-capacity units with beefier inverters and adequate solar input let you power more tools for longer and recharge faster. What maintenance and compatibility tips should I follow when using a solar generator to charge power tools?

Ensure compatibility by matching your tools’ voltage (110V or 220V) with the generator’s output and keeping the inverter on a pure sine wave. Keep solar panels clean and free of shade to maximize charging, and store the unit in a cool, ventilated area to protect the battery. Use the recommended cables and adapters, avoid overloading outlets, and monitor battery health to extend longevity. What common issues might occur when using a solar generator for charging power tools, and how can I fix them?

If your tools aren’t drawing power, verify the generator is charged, outlets are active, and the inverter isn’t overloaded by a single tool. Check that solar input isn’t blocked by shade or debris and that the panel is properly connected. If charging is slow, increase sun exposure or use a higher‑watt panel; ensure the battery isn’t near full and the MPPT controller is functioning.
